Sales leads should plan for two offsite sessions per quarter and budget travel accordingly. We are also piloting a mentorship stipend in the Karvel region; results will inform the broader rollout. Please review the draft figures before Thursday's session. Context on the underlying plan appears directly below.

— Derrin Hale, VP Enablement

board note of kagep-yahig: Only 9 of the 120 pilot accounts renewed Quenix, so a churn review is set for April 1.

Handover — Annual Billing Transition

To the incoming director: Pellarch Software shifts all subscriptions to annual billing effective next fiscal year. Monthly plans close to new signups in March. Migration discounts approved for legacy accounts; churn modeling done by the Ralbeck team, worst case 6%. Finance tooling update is mid-build — chase the Ardenfold group weekly or it slips. Renewal comms drafted, not sent. Legal cleared terms. Everything else is in the shared tracker. One last item follows below, and it stays between us.

board note of kagaf-tahog: Ulaoxek Systems is in early talks to buy Ralokek Group for about $329.6 million. The Wenys launch date is September 16, and nothing goes to the press before then. Legal wants the Keloxox Foods term sheet signed before June 7.

// Notes for the release manager: this is the fix for the Pigeonloft
// websocket reconnect storm (tickets from the Harwick rollout). The old
// code retried instantly with no jitter, so one blip meant thousands of
// simultaneous reconnects. We now do exponential backoff with jitter and
// a hard retry ceiling. Please don't tweak these per-environment without
// a load test first. The backoff parameters are as follows.

constants for kageg-bawif:
QUOTAS = {
    "quenwyn": 1,
    "oliix": 10,
}

To: Executive Team
From: Finance
Subject: Loyalty-programme overhaul — Brightmoor Rewards

The redesigned Brightmoor Rewards structure replaces points with tiered credits from next quarter. Projected redemption liability falls by 14%, and breakage assumptions have been revised accordingly. Full cost model is attached for review. The confidential rationale behind this change is appended below.

board note of baweg-bawig: Project Tamath slips by six weeks because of the audit delay.